Our mission

The modern business world is changing.  New technologies and approaches have opened up a range of exciting possibilities. We give invaluable support to companies outside of the UK who need an office and presence here.  Our commitment is to provide the administrative support you need to start up your business in the UK. 

Assisting Businesses to Succeed

Our mission is to assist you in overcoming some of the key challenges of global competition and the global marketplace.  We accomplish this by offering you the kind of services that stand to transform your business and open up scores of new opportunities.

SOA Challenges provides staffing as necessary, thereby eliminating the need for businesses to hire consultants and personnel.  Further, as an IT firm, our company reduces your costs through solutions like cloud computing.  This means that companies can avoid expenses that would otherwise be associated with paying for services like document management, website development and online backup.  Our many services include acting as your registered office address, business process management, administrative assistance, accounting, auditing and notary services, and much more.

Establishing a UK Corporate Presence

Working outside your home country can be exciting, but it can also present unique challenges, such as rules and procedures.  SOA Challenges Ltd. has the experience, knowledge, infrastructure and skills necessary to help you accomplish more inside the UK.

With SOA Challenges Ltd. you can outsource a range of your business needs and your IT to us, allowing you to succeed with company formation right here in London, UK.